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02487377 931 39 1453
20968911 102631
20968911 102631
96 7618836370 3911 521932103
All about undefined
Interested in learning more?
20968911 102631
96 7618836370 3911 521932103
See more
5533 72105
0430 29839146 00758 47479
See more
547435494 27847 3434619
3317005523 88573 4469 3294
See more